Building Trust in the Era of Digital Transformation

As digital platforms continue to evolve, the core challenge remains: how do brands and communities establish genuine trust and meaningful connections with their audiences? In an age saturated with automated bots, superficial interactions, and algorithms that favor engagement over authenticity, the need for credible, human-centered content has never been greater. Recent industry analyses demonstrate that consumers are increasingly scrutinizing the origins of the information they consume, seeking transparency and relatability from the sources they trust.

The Evolution of Digital Engagement Strategies

Traditional Approaches Modern, Authentic Strategies
Mass broadcasting with generic content Personalized storytelling tailored to community interests
Automated responses & scripted interactions Genuine human engagement & transparent communication
Focus on metrics & virality Focus on building trust & long-term relationships

Industry leaders recognize that authentic engagement fosters deeper loyalty. While click-through rates and share counts offer short-term metrics, long-term relationship building requires transparency, consistency, and a genuine representation of brand values. This approach not only supports ethical marketing principles but also enhances search engine credibility and improves brand reputation.

The Future Outlook: Authenticity in a Data-Driven World

Looking ahead, the integration of artificial intelligence and data analytics will enable brands to craft even more personalized and authentic experiences. However, the human element—empathy, storytelling, and transparency—must remain central. Industry insights suggest that consumers will increasingly value brands that demonstrate real commitment through honest narratives and consistent engagement efforts.
